Abstract

The "vicious circle" metaphor of mutually reinforcing poverty, weak school performance, unemployment, discrimination and social distance from the majority population is often used to describe the social status of the Roma ethnic community in most countries. The book presents quantitative and qualitative data collected on a representative sample of the Roma population in Croatia that describe its specific social position, but also the needs and experiences in the fields of education and employment. The authors make specific recommendations for social policy makers based on psychosocial theories of education and employment.
